Windows 10 32-bit operating systems can use a maximum of 4GB of RAM. This limitation is due to the architecture of 32-bit systems, which can only address up to 4GB of memory. Users looking to utilize more RAM should consider upgrading to a 64-bit version of Windows 10.
Why Is RAM Limited in 32-Bit Systems?
The limitation of 4GB RAM on a 32-bit Windows 10 system is rooted in the system’s architecture. A 32-bit processor can only manage a maximum of 2^32 memory addresses, which translates to 4GB. This restriction applies to all 32-bit operating systems, not just Windows.

Benefits of Upgrading to a 64-Bit System
Switching to a 64-bit version of Windows 10 can significantly enhance your computer’s capabilities:
- Increased RAM Capacity: 64-bit systems can handle more than 4GB of RAM, typically up to 128GB or more, depending on the version of Windows 10.
- Improved Performance: With more RAM, applications run more efficiently, and multitasking becomes seamless.
- Enhanced Security: 64-bit Windows includes additional security features not available in 32-bit versions.

What is the Difference Between 32-Bit and 64-Bit Windows?
The primary difference lies in the amount of memory each can address. A 32-bit system can use up to 4GB of RAM, while a 64-bit system can support significantly more, enhancing performance and allowing for more complex applications.
Can I Run 32-Bit Programs on a 64-Bit System?
Yes, a 64-bit Windows system can run 32-bit programs thanks to the Windows-on-Windows 64 (WoW64) emulation layer. This compatibility ensures that most software will function correctly on a 64-bit system.

How Can I Check If My Computer is 32-Bit or 64-Bit?
You can check your system type by navigating to Settings > System > About. Here, you’ll find information about whether your processor and operating system are 32-bit or 64-bit.
What Are the System Requirements for 64-Bit Windows 10?
The basic requirements for 64-bit Windows 10 include a 1 GHz processor, 2GB of RAM, and 20GB of hard drive space. However, for optimal performance, a more powerful system is recommended.
